Ella across two different records

The Census count answers “how many people had this name?” using a national snapshot of living residents in 2020. The SSA series answers “when was this name popular?” using Social Security card applications associated with births.

Ella reached its highest published annual SSA count in 2010, with 9,898 recorded births. In 2025, SSA recorded 5,831 babies with the name.

Names do not determine a person’s identity. Demographic percentages above describe national aggregates and should never be applied to an individual.
